Res. Hall Manager (Incl. Room, Board) jobs in Trenton, NJ

Res. Hall Manager (Incl. Room, Board) oversees all activities of a residence hall. Oversees the maintenance and renovation, purchase and inventory of supplies, assignment of rooms and summer housing, and housekeeping functions. Being a Res. Hall Manager (Incl. Room, Board) is responsible for student housing assignment, maintenance of facilities, and safety of residents. Ensures students follow college/university conduct policies and takes appropriate disciplinary actions when rules are broken. Additionally, Res. Hall Manager (Incl. Room, Board) room and board in the residence hall is included in the terms of employment. May require a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a director. The Res. Hall Manager (Incl. Room, Board) supervises a group of primarily para-professional level staffs. May also be a level above a supervisor within high volume administrative/ production environments. Makes day-to-day decisions within or for a group/small department. Has some authority for personnel actions. Thorough knowledge of department processes. To be a Res. Hall Manager (Incl. Room, Board) typically requires 3-5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

According to the United States Census Bureau, the city had a total area of 8.155 square miles (21.122 km2), including 7.648 square miles (19.809 km2) of land and 0.507 square mile (1.313 km2) of water (6.21%). Several bridges across the Delaware River – the Trenton–Morrisville Toll Bridge, Lower Trenton Bridge and Calhoun Street Bridge – connect Trenton to Morrisville, Pennsylvania, all of which are operated by the Delaware River Joint Toll Bridge Commission.
